The narrative follows Juanita Slusher, famously known as Candy Barr, a celebrated burlesque dancer in 1950s Vegas who captivated audiences with her dynamic performances. Her tumultuous journey began with a traumatic childhood marked by betrayal, leading her to a life of escape and exploitation. Candy's rise to fame brought her into the orbit of influential figures, but it also led to legal troubles and entanglements with significant historical events, including the investigation into President Kennedy's assassination.
